Émille Gallé, Bed, 1900
Tumblr media
Émille Gallé, Aube et Crépuscule, bed, 1900. Palisander, ebony, mother-of-pearl, iridiscent glass.

I also finally wore "Cleric" from the RPG series. I was a little wary about trying more of their D&D-themed perfumes given that I wasn't a big fan of "Fighter" due to it smelling like new car seat, and "Elf" was kind of "eh," but after getting a free sample of "Lawful" and seeing it pop up in the recommendations, I had to try it.
It's really good! I'm surprised it wasn't described as "incense" though, because this reminds me of the way certain very old Catholic cathedral interiors sometimes smell when the incense they use for the censer gets into the walls and tablecloths and lingers in the air long after Mass is over, or people have lit up a whole bunch of prayer candles by the donation box. They mention "rose amber" here, which I'm assuming is amber mixed with rose oil. The faint rose mixed with the woods and spices increases the impression of "incense" and candle smoke, even though the incense note is technically absent.
Its note list is pretty complicated, and I can't identify most of the stuff described here:
Rose amber, frankincense, myrrh, champaca flower, Peru balsam, cistus, palisander, cananga, hyssop, and narcissus absolute.
However, it's interesting that frankincense and myrrh pop up in here. The combo's always been a little hit-or-miss for me depending on who actually formulates the scent. I love it in perfume, but I didn't like it as much as that one Shea Moisture body wash I tried, maybe because it also had some coconut oil mixed in. But here it's really nice. I think I like them when paired with rose or something else that makes the odor smoky.
Balsam's another odd note that I'm not sure if I like or dislike. I tried the "Dead Leaves and Green Balsam" seasonal perfume for Halloween, but I didn't like it as much as I like the balsam-scented candle I keep at my desk for amateur aromatherapy when I get stressed from abstract work stuff or worries about the future and need to distract myself with something nice and firmly grounded in sensory reality. It's like...I enjoy woody and resinous notes, but not all woods are created equal, and some of them I only like if they're in certain "contexts" paired with certain other notes. Oak is a favorite of mine, but I seem to like it best when it's paired with something else, usually something that contrasts like a floral, green, or amber.

“Masumi” by Coty was first launched in 1967 and was a Chypre Floral fragrance. It had top notes of Palisander rosewood, bergamot, pineapple, and melon, middle notes of cardamom, rose and violet, and base notes of oakmoss, Virginia cedar, musk, sandalwood, amber and vanilla.
Coty said this of the fragrance:
“Masumi Coty was launched in 1967 as a floral – green – chypre fragrance. It is inspired by the Far East and emotions of bliss, serenity and calmness.”
